Mercedes formally launch championship defender W08

Mercedes have formally launched the W08 EQ Power+ at Silverstone following a filming session on Thursday morning.

Lewis Hamilton ran a series of filming laps before completing a shakedown of the new car. Valtteri Bottas is due to do the same in the afternoon.

“The new rules for 2017 were designed to make the fastest F1 cars ever through a big increase in aerodynamic performance,” said Toto Wolff.

“They should be more physical to drive and hopefully more spectacular for the fans to watch. The proof will come in the opening races but we have probably achieved that target.

“Of course, in terms of relative performance, it’s clear that any rule change brings with it a big reset but also a big opportunity.

“This is the time to stay humble and keep our feet on the ground. None of the teams has raced under these rules and we all have the same points right now: zero.

“But the dominant feeling in the team right now is one of excitement – the factory is buzzing with anticipation.

“It has been a really motivating challenge to develop a brand new car concept and I have never seen our determination to succeed higher than it is right now.”

The car as yet does not feature a shark fin, although Mercedes are expected to test one in Barcelona.

The current world champions are the fourth team to unveil their 2017 car. Sauber, Renault and Force India have already launched their cars this week. Williams have released rendered images of their new car.

Bottas joins the team for 2017 from Williams to replace the retired world champion Nico Rosberg.

“It’s a new chapter in my career, a new team, new regulations… new everything!” Bottas said.

“I’ve been waiting for a long time to get this car out on track and, although this is just a Filming Day, I’m looking forward to starting to test properly next week in Barcelona and to really understand the car that we’ve been given by everybody in Brixworth and Brackley.

“It has been a busy winter for me since signing with Mercedes and we have tried to make the most of the time we have had.

“We’ve been going day by day, making the most of each one, spending a lot of time in Brackley and going through as much stuff as possible with the engineers.

“In terms of my physical preparation, I think I have done the most amount of training of any winter so far. I have done some good training camps and feel in the best shape I’ve ever been, definitely ready for the season ahead.”

Mercedes also announced their driver line-up for the first pre-season test in Barcelona. Bottas will drive Monday and Wednesday morning and Tuesday and Thursday afternoon.

Hamilton will drive Tuesday and Thursday morning and Monday and Wednesday afternoon.
